High Temp is available in 25, 50, and 100 micron layer … WebMar 13, 2024 · Not enough mils – For best results, apply the gelcoat to a wet film thickness of 25 mils. This will result in a cured film thickness of 18-22 mils. As gelcoat cures, it gives off heat in an exothermic chemical reaction. If the gelcoat is applied to thin, it will not reach the temperature needed and will not cure fully.

WebMEKP is the catalyst needed to cure polyester resin. This should be done at room temperature. Add more or less catalyst depending on how long of a pot life and working time is desired. Pot life is the amount of time it takes before the resin hardens in a mixing cup. The ideal temperature to work in is 70 degrees. WebPolyester and vinyl ester resins are the most commonly used matrix resins to create composite parts. Polyester resins, also known as Unsaturated Polyester Resins (UPR), combined with fiberglass reinforcements have been the building blocks of the composites industry for decades. WebDec 15, 2010 · A vinylester resin, by comparison, can elongate up to 5 percent of its length before fracturing and has a tensile strength of about 11,800 pounds per square inch. This makes vinylester the resin of choice when laminating with more sophisticated fabrics. WebAug 8, 2007 · Careful, as you don't want to weaken the underlying section by sanding too much away. Get some peel ply, put it on the wet layup, and roll or squeegee it on. You can come back in a day or ten years, remove the peel ply, and do the next layup. The surface will be ready by just removing the peel ply, sand any shiny spots. The above is for epoxy ...
